Miura Sensei Shared His Visons On Future Character Introductions In Berserk

Casca from Berserk

In an extremely candid interview, Miura Sensei spoke on new character introductions and his wish to not create something akin to a “man’s world” in the story. He wanted to strive for balance, knowing that there had to be many women who would move the story in important ways. Miura brought depth and complexity into the Berserk universe to ensure his creation would transcend generations.

Advertisement

First of all, I want to add more female characters. Since having only a “man’s world” is not well balanced, one or two new female characters are needed. And important new characters should be introduced as well. They are related to Guts in a way similar to the Band of the Falcon, instead of taking their place. Staying alone is too hard for Guts. However, these characters aren’t as close to him as the Band of the Falcon. They can be rather hostile with him. I’ve conceived some characters with whom the story development can be varied.
